实时渲染(Real-time Rendering)和计算机视觉(Computer Vision,简称CV)技术的结合,是推动虚拟现实(Virtual Reality,简称VR)和增强现实(Augmented Reality,简称AR)产业发展的关键。本文将带您深入了解实时渲染CV技术的原理、应用场景及其在虚拟现实与增强现实产业中的重要作用。
实时渲染CV技术原理
1. 实时渲染
实时渲染是指在计算机上实时生成图形、图像的过程。它要求在极短的时间内(通常小于0.1秒)完成图形的计算、生成和显示。实时渲染技术在游戏、影视制作、虚拟现实等领域有着广泛应用。
2. 计算机视觉
计算机视觉是研究如何让计算机从图像和视频中获取信息的学科。它包括图像处理、模式识别、机器学习等多个领域。计算机视觉技术在自动驾驶、人脸识别、图像搜索等方面发挥着重要作用。
3. 实时渲染CV技术
实时渲染CV技术是将实时渲染和计算机视觉技术相结合,实现计算机在短时间内对图像或视频进行实时处理和分析的技术。该技术主要包括以下方面:
- 图像预处理:对输入的图像进行缩放、裁剪、去噪等处理,以提高后续处理的速度和准确性。
- 特征提取:从图像中提取关键信息,如边缘、角点、纹理等,以便后续处理。
- 目标检测:在图像中定位感兴趣的目标,如物体、人脸等。
- 场景理解:根据提取的特征和目标检测结果,对场景进行理解,如判断场景类型、识别物体属性等。
- 实时渲染:根据场景理解结果,实时生成相应的视觉效果。
实时渲染CV技术应用场景
1. 虚拟现实
- 沉浸式游戏:实时渲染CV技术可以为游戏场景提供实时、真实的视觉效果,提升用户体验。
- 虚拟旅游:通过实时渲染CV技术,用户可以在家中体验世界各地的风景名胜。
- 远程协作:实时渲染CV技术可以实现远程会议、协作等场景,打破地域限制。
2. 增强现实
- 移动AR:通过手机或平板电脑等移动设备,实时渲染CV技术可以将虚拟信息叠加到现实世界中,实现导航、购物、游戏等功能。
- 眼镜AR:实时渲染CV技术可以实现眼镜AR产品,如谷歌眼镜,为用户提供更为便捷、智能的生活体验。
- 工业AR:实时渲染CV技术在工业领域可用于远程维修、质量控制、设备监控等场景。
实时渲染CV技术发展趋势
1. 软硬件协同发展
随着硬件性能的提升和软件算法的优化,实时渲染CV技术将更加高效、精准。
2. 多模态融合
实时渲染CV技术将与其他技术,如语音识别、自然语言处理等,实现多模态融合,为用户提供更加丰富、智能的体验。
3. 个性化定制
实时渲染CV技术将根据用户的需求和喜好,实现个性化定制,满足不同场景下的应用需求。
总之,实时渲染CV技术作为推动虚拟现实与增强现实产业发展的重要技术,将在未来发挥越来越重要的作用。通过深入了解该技术的原理、应用场景和发展趋势,我们期待实时渲染CV技术为人类带来更加美好的未来。
